<output id="qn6qe"></output>

    1. <output id="qn6qe"><tt id="qn6qe"></tt></output>
    2. <strike id="qn6qe"></strike>

      亚洲 日本 欧洲 欧美 视频,日韩中文字幕有码av,一本一道av中文字幕无码,国产线播放免费人成视频播放,人妻少妇偷人无码视频,日夜啪啪一区二区三区,国产尤物精品自在拍视频首页,久热这里只有精品12

      最少代碼的瀑布流實現

      先看效果圖吧:

       

      JS代碼先放上來給大家看下思路。具體實現還是需要css和html代碼的,可以看我的在線源代碼和效果:

      全屏,chrome,瀏覽最佳

      http://runjs.cn/detail/j9qlhajc

      $(function(){
            $('#brand-waterfall').waterfall();
      });
      
      // 瀑布流插件
      // pannysp 2013.4.9
      ;(function ($) {
          $.fn.waterfall = function(options) {
              var df = {
                  item: '.item',
                  margin: 15,
                  addfooter: true
              };
              options = $.extend(df, options);
              return this.each(function() {
                  var $box = $(this), pos = [],
                  _box_width = $box.width(),
                  $items = $box.find(options.item),
                  _owidth = $items.eq(0).outerWidth() + options.margin,
                  _oheight = $items.eq(0).outerHeight() + options.margin,
                  _num = Math.floor(_box_width/_owidth);
      
                  (function() {
                      var i = 0;
                      for (; i < _num; i++) {
                          pos.push([i*_owidth,0]);
                      } 
                  })();
      
                  $items.each(function() {
                      var _this = $(this),
                      _temp = 0,
                      _height = _this.outerHeight() + options.margin;
      
                      _this.hover(function() {
                          _this.addClass('hover');
                      },function() {
                          _this.removeClass('hover');
                      });
      
                      for (var j = 0; j < _num; j++) {
                          if(pos[j][1] < pos[_temp][1]){
                              //暫存top值最小那列的index
                              _temp = j;
                          }
                      }
                      this.style.cssText = 'left:'+pos[_temp][0]+'px; top:'+pos[_temp][1]+'px;';
                      //插入后,更新下該列的top值
                      pos[_temp][1] = pos[_temp][1] + _height;
                  });
      
                  // 計算top值最大的賦給外圍div
                  (function() {
                      var i = 0, tops = [];
                      for (; i < _num; i++) {
                          tops.push(pos[i][1]);
                      }
                      tops.sort(function(a,b) {
                          return a-b;
                      });
                      $box.height(tops[_num-1]);
      
                      //增加尾部填充div
                      if(options.addfooter){
                          addfooter(tops[_num-1]);
                      }
                  })();
      
                  function addfooter(max) {
                      var addfooter = document.createElement('div');
                      addfooter.className = 'item additem';
                      for (var i = 0; i < _num; i++) {
                          if(max != pos[i][1]){
                              var clone = addfooter.cloneNode(),
                              _height = max - pos[i][1] - options.margin;
                              clone.style.cssText = 'left:'+pos[i][0]+'px; top:'+pos[i][1]+'px; height:'+_height+'px;';
                              $box[0].appendChild(clone);
                          }
                      }
                  }
              });
          }
      })(jQuery);

       

      posted @ 2013-04-09 17:38  盼少  閱讀(2717)  評論(8)    收藏  舉報
      主站蜘蛛池模板: 久久综合九色综合欧洲98| 亚洲人成电影在线天堂色| 色一情一区二区三区四区| 亚洲春色在线视频| 亚洲暴爽av天天爽日日碰| bt天堂新版中文在线| 国产日韩精品欧美一区灰 | 亚洲精品国产综合久久一线| 中文 在线 日韩 亚洲 欧美| 男同精品视频免费观看网站| 亚洲中文字幕无码永久在线| 久久久久国产精品人妻| 国产又爽又黄的精品视频| 蜜桃在线一区二区三区| 新郑市| 欧美人与动牲交a免费| 91国产自拍一区二区三区 | 国产精品特级毛片一区二区三区| 婷婷色香五月综合缴缴情香蕉| 国产精品美女免费无遮挡| 国产亚洲第一精品| 欧洲一区二区中文字幕| 久久理论片午夜琪琪电影网| 精品一卡2卡三卡4卡乱码精品视频 | jizzjizz日本高潮喷水| 亚洲精品欧美综合二区| 一区二区福利在线视频| 成人一区二区三区在线午夜| 99久久无码私人网站| 国产精品中文字幕第一区| 日韩在线观看精品亚洲| 亚洲中文字幕在线无码一区二区| av中文字幕国产精品| 少妇粉嫩小泬喷水视频www| 久久精品免视看国产成人| 国产精品永久免费成人av| 亚洲ⅴa曰本va欧美va视频| 当雄县| 国产高颜值不卡一区二区| 起碰免费公开97在线视频| 四虎永久精品免费视频|